Millan, depending which part of pasir panjang, some schools that your bro can consider will be QiFa, Fairfield Methodist, radin mas, chij kellock. These schools that I have mentioned are more than 1km, unfortunately. Schools such as Fairfield, radin mas are hotly contested even for PV while others are manageable depending on that year’s enrollment. So it really come down to what your bro’s expectation for his kid/s.

PH has long history (since 1889), just like many other top schools and has a strong academic background. You will know what I mean if you refer to the \"Ranking by Academic Excellence\" site.
BTPS on the other hand has good CCAs with impressive achievements from its Brass Band. Have heard good reviews about the school too with committed teachers.
You need to ascertain your own set of criteria before deciding which school to send your son to.
For us, we choose PH due to the following reasons:
- proximity to school (save on travelling time and tpt fees)
- strong Chinese culture and environment
- SAP school (Yes! I want my DS to do HCL Some said I am crazy cos DS is quite \"potato\")
- proven academic records as it is one of the top NON-GEP school
- mission school
The only push factor was the CCAs offer by PH. I prefer the CCAs in BTPS, but the pull factors for PH are definitely over-weighted than BTPS's based on our criteria above. I am also prepared to brave through the storm with DS as many have warned me about the stress that I will face. -
